Daniel Olcina Olcina (born 25 January 1989 in Albaida, Valencia) is a Spanish footballer who plays for UD Benigànim as a forward.

A product of Valencia CF's youth ranks, Olcina made his debut for the first team on 27 August 2009, when he came on as a substitute in the UEFA Europa League match against Stabæk Fotball, a 4–1 home win.[1] Released by the Che in the 2011 summer he resumed his career in the lower leagues, in his native region.
